>> I am developing a RCP+P2 application and wonder what's the best way
>> to test such an application. As far as I understand I need to deploy
>> my RCP+P2 application before I can test it as P2 requires a profile
>> when installing/updating etc. software. This profile is NULL when
>> testing within Eclipse IDE so debugging in IDE is not possible for me
> yet.
>>
>> Is there a way to test P2 without deployment e.g. mock a profile?
>>
>
> In 3.6, on the Eclipse Application Configuration tab, you can check the
> "Support software installation in the launched application" option. This
> will mock up a profile in the launched target.
